New Rest Area for Visitors


The National Museum of Korea (Director Kim Youngna) recently completed the renovation of its rest area for visitors, located between the Goguryeo and Baekje Galleries on the first floor of the Permanent Exhibition Hall. In the new rest area, visitors can browse a collection of about 300 books that includes art books published by the NMK and other books on museums and Korean culture, while they relax in our new comfortable couches. The new rest area is part of NMK’s ongoing effort to provide a comfortable and efficient environment
